EXCEEDS logo
Exceeds
Ranisa Gupta

PROFILE

Ranisa Gupta

Worked on the FAIMS/FAIMS3 repository, delivering 73 features and resolving 22 bugs over five months with a focus on UI/UX consistency, robust theming, and reliable form workflows. Built and refined React and TypeScript components for forms, mapping, and data grids, emphasizing maintainability and accessibility. Enhanced map integration using Mapbox GL JS and OpenLayers, improved geolocation accuracy, and modernized UI patterns for onboarding and usability. Applied CSS-in-JS and Material UI to ensure responsive design and theme alignment. Prioritized clean code organization, thorough testing, and scalable configuration, resulting in a stable, designer-friendly platform that supports rapid feature iteration and business value.

Overall Statistics

Feature vs Bugs

77%Features

Repository Contributions

221Total
Bugs
22
Commits
221
Features
73
Lines of code
219,737
Activity Months5

Your Network

31 people

Work History

April 2025

74 Commits • 28 Features

Apr 1, 2025

April 2025 FAIMS3 monthly summary focusing on delivering stable, UX-centric features and high-impact map capabilities, with an emphasis on reliability, maintainability, and measurable business value.

March 2025

40 Commits • 13 Features

Mar 1, 2025

March 2025 performance: Delivered a refined publish workflow, extended designer form controls to support viewsets, and strengthened testing and code hygiene across FAIMS/FAIMS3. These efforts reduced publishing friction for users, minimized navigation errors, and improved maintainability and CI health.

February 2025

81 Commits • 23 Features

Feb 1, 2025

February 2025 monthly summary for FAIMS/FAIMS3 focused on delivering core UI/UX improvements, robust theming, and stability enhancements that drive business value through a smoother user experience, consistent visuals, and more reliable form workflows across surveys and locations. The work spanned color theming utilities, form error handling, view logic, and location/map interactions, with a strong emphasis on maintainability and test readiness.

January 2025

16 Commits • 6 Features

Jan 1, 2025

January 2025 FAIMS3: Delivered a cohesive, designer-friendly form UI system that accelerates form-building and improves consistency and accessibility. Highlights include a new FAIMS Text Field component registered in the bundle and designer, a FieldWrapper framework standardized across MultiSelect, RadioGroup, and Select with theming support, TakePhoto UI enhancements aligned to the FieldWrapper design, a new NumberField component with min/max/step and designer/bundle registration, and theming improvements adding HelpText color for clearer guidance. These changes enable faster form composition, a more consistent user experience, clearer styling, and easier maintenance across the product.

November 2024

10 Commits • 3 Features

Nov 1, 2024

November 2024 focused on UI polish, responsiveness, and theming consistency for FAIMS3. Delivered user-facing enhancements across Notebook surface/activation, App Bar and User Header, and Data Grid search, translating design system alignment into tangible improvements for usability and onboarding. The work reduced visual noise, improved accessibility hints, and established scalable UI patterns for future iterations, with a strong emphasis on maintainability and clean commit hygiene.

Activity

Loading activity data...

Quality Metrics

Correctness86.4%
Maintainability86.8%
Architecture78.0%
Performance82.0%
AI Usage20.2%

Skills & Technologies

Programming Languages

CSSHTMLJSONJavaScriptPythonReactTypeScriptYAMLtsx

Technical Skills

Backend DevelopmentCSSCSS AnimationsCSS-in-JSCapacitorCode OrganizationCode RefactoringComponent DesignComponent DevelopmentComponent ManagementComponent RefactoringComponent RegistrationComponent StylingConfiguration ManagementDataGrid

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

FAIMS/FAIMS3

Nov 2024 Apr 2025
5 Months active

Languages Used

CSSJavaScriptTypeScripttsxJSONYAMLHTMLPython

Technical Skills

CSS-in-JSFront End DevelopmentFront-end DevelopmentFrontend DevelopmentMaterial UIMaterial-UI